This was another amazing year for our Prison Ministry team. To date in 2012, we visited 156 prisons in the United States and distributed 215,000 bars of soap, bottles of shampoo and copies of Joyce's books to inmates. We held 132 services in the prisons and were able to lead 10,767 inmates to the Lord! We recently visited all 50 prisons in California where we saw a lot of thankful men and women. One man in particular, in the High Desert facility, comes to mind. He showed me an empty shampoo bottle he had from our previous visit in 2002. He had kept it as a reminder of someone caring enough to visit and giving the inmates gifts. He couldn't get over the fact we were back again with gifts for everyone. He just lit up with smiles and tons of thanks.
